Today we have new trailers for:
  • Disney's upcoming adventure film "Jungle Cruise" inspired by the classic Disneyland theme park ride of the same name. Directed by Jaume Collet-Serra ("Non-Stop", "The Shallows"), the film stars Dwayne Johnson, Emily Blunt, Jack Whitehall, Paul Giamatti, Jesse Plemons and Edgar Ramirez.
  • Universal's family adventure film "Dolittle" starring Robert Downey Jr. in his first post-Avengers role. The film is co-written and directed by Oscar winner Stephen Gaghan ("Traffic", "Syriana"), and the cast also features Jessie Buckley, Harry Collett, Antonio Banderas, Michael Sheen, Jim Broadbent, and the voices of Rami Malek, Emma Thompson, Selena Gomez, Kumail Nanjiani, John Cena and Marion Cotillard.
  • The upcoming "Charlie's Angels" reboot produced and directed by Elizabeth Banks ("Pitch Perfect"). The film stars Kristen Stewart, Naomi Scott, Ella Balinska, Patrick Stewart, Djimon Hounsou and Sam Claflin.
  • Disney's animated sequel "Frozen 2" featuring the voices of Kristen Bell, Idina Menzel, Josh Gad, Jonathan Groff, Sterling K. Brown and Evan Rachel Wood.
  • The action thriller "The Courier" written and directed by British genre filmmaker Zackary Adler ("The Rise of the Krays"). The film stars Olga Kurylenko, Gary Oldman, Dermot Mulroney and Amit Shah.
  • The psychological horror thriller "Daniel Isn't Real" starring Miles Robbins ("Blockers"), Patrick Schwarzenegger ("Scouts Guide to the Zombie Apocalypse"), Sasha Lane ("Hellboy") and Mary Stuart Masterson ("Blindspot").

Today we have new trailers for:
  • The zombie comedy sequel "Zombieland: Double Tap". Woody Harrelson, Jesse Eisenberg, Emma Stone and Abigail Breslin are back, stil together, and still trying to survive the zombie apocalypse. They are joined by fellow survivors Rosario Dawson, Luke Wilson, Thomas Middleditch, Zoey Deutch and Avan Jogia.
  • The sci-fi thriller "Gemini Man" starring Will Smith. The film is directed by Oscar-winning filmmaker Ang Lee ("Life of Pi", "Brokeback Mountain") and produced by Jerry Bruckheimer ("Bad Boys", "Pirates of the Caribbean"). The cast also includes Clive Owen, Mary Elizabeth Winstead and Benedict Wong.
  • The horror film "Scary Stories to Tell in the Dark" produced by Guillermo del Toro. The film is inspired by a collection of short horror stories by writer Alvin Schwartz and illustrator Stephen Gammell.
  • The teen post-apocalyptic thriller "Riot Girls" directed by former horror magazine editor Jovanka Vuckovic from a script written by television writer Katherine Collins ("Blindspot", "Lost in Space").
  • The psychological thriller "Daniel Isn't Real" produced by Elijah Wood and directed by horror filmmaker Adam Egypt Mortimer ("Some Kind of Hate"). The film stars Miles Robbins, Patrick Schwarzenegger, Sasha Lane, Hannah Marks and Mary Stuart Masterson.
  • The upcoming CBS All Access series "Why Women Kill" from Marc Cherry, creator of "Desperate Housewives". The show stars Ginnifer Goodwin, Lucy Liu, Kirby Howell-Baptiste, Sam Jaeger, Jack Davenport, Reid Scott and Alexandra Daddario.
